访问VTK官方网站(https://www.vtk.org/download/)下载适合你的VTK版本。
选择与你的操作系统和位数(32位或64位)相对应的安装包。
安装Visual Studio(推荐使用Visual Studio 2017或2019)。
安装CMake(用于生成Visual Studio项目文件)。
使用CMake GUI或命令行工具来配置VTK源码。
在CMake中设置源码路径和构建路径。
选择相应的Visual Studio版本和编译选项(如32位或64位)。
生成Visual Studio解决方案文件(.sln)。
打开生成的Visual Studio解决方案文件。
设置启动项目并编译项目(可能需要编译Debug和Release两个版本)。
在Visual Studio中编译INSTALL项目,这将安装VTK的库文件和头文件到指定的安装路径。
确保你的Python环境已经安装,并且可以正常使用pip。
使用pip安装VTK的Python绑定。例如,对于Python 3.7,你可以使用以下命令:
pip install vtk
如果你使用的是Anaconda,可以使用conda来安装VTK:
conda install -c conda-forge vtk
在Python环境中尝试导入VTK模块,如果导入成功则表示安装成功。
访问VTK官方网站(https://www.vtk.org/download/)下载适合你的VTK版本whl。
不用上面的,直接pip install vtk就行